[發明專利]一種基于自優化的啟發式政務云數據復合查詢方法在審
| 申請號: | 201810396475.5 | 申請日: | 2018-04-28 |
| 公開(公告)號: | CN108595654A | 公開(公告)日: | 2018-09-28 |
| 發明(設計)人: | 李富平;冷霜;李云霞 | 申請(專利權)人: | 李富平 |
| 主分類號: | G06F17/30 | 分類號: | G06F17/30 |
| 代理公司: | 北京東方盛凡知識產權代理事務所(普通合伙) 11562 | 代理人: | 牟炳彥 |
| 地址: | 264000 山東省煙臺市芝*** | 國省代碼: | 山東;37 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 復合 查詢 數據復合 啟發式 自優化 站點 查詢計劃 查詢結果 查詢條件 關系代數 集中處理 拓撲模型 網絡狀況 占用資源 實時性 云網絡 尋址 隊列 并發 篩選 | ||
本發明公開了一種基于自優化的啟發式云數據復合查詢方法。主要包括:A.建立政務云網絡的關系拓撲模型,并對其復合查詢連接以及處理過程進行關系代數描述;B.采用動態半連接機制生成當前任務的最優查詢計劃,并尋址到最佳處理站點;C.根據復合查詢條件隊列,采用“并發篩選,集中處理”的原則,得到最終的復合查詢結果。該方法具有占用資源少、實時性強,并可根據當前的網絡狀況,選擇最優計劃和站點,穩定可靠地完成復合查詢任務。
技術領域
本發明屬于互聯網、大數據和信息技術領域,具體涉及一種基于自優化的啟發式政務云數據復合查詢方法。
背景技術
隨著國家信息化戰略的深入推進以及互聯網和云數據處理技術的快速發展,在政務、商務以及企業應用系統數據都廣泛地采用分布式云數據存儲技術,這些分布式數據節點具有高度的自治性,節點很多,查詢條件維度的偶發性強,數據分布很難預先確定,并且異地節點間的通信環境不穩定等特點。而目前的分布式云數據復合查詢方法對于所有節點通通采用對稱式處理,無法根據各自治數據節點網絡的實際狀態做出調整,因而浪費通信資源、時效性不佳,經常會因某一節點異常造成間歇性的查詢錯誤。
發明內容
為解決上述問題,本發明的目的在于提供一種自身具有優化能力,并且實時性好的啟發式復合查詢方法。
本發明解決其問題所采用的技術方案,包括以下步驟:
一種基于自優化的啟發式政務云數據復合查詢方法,其特征在于:所述方法包括以下步驟:
A.建立政務云網絡的關系拓撲模型,并對其復合查詢連接以及處理過程進行關系代數描述;
B.采用動態半連接機制進行多維條件輪詢,從而生成當前任務的最優查詢計劃,并尋址到最佳處理站點,實現啟發式復合查詢;
C.根據復合查詢條件隊列,采用“并發篩選,集中處理”的原則,得到最終的復合查詢結果。
優選的,所述步驟A包括:
(1)政務云網絡的關系拓撲模型包括若干站點和客戶端,在拓撲模型中,建立了分布式數據查詢的本質模型;
(2)對于政務云的拓撲模型的分布式復合查詢過程利用關系代數描述如下:
(Dri,j,k)表示滿足查詢條件的關系數據集合Dri從站點Sitej傳輸到Sitek的過程;
CSS(Dri,j,k)表示關系數據集合Dri從站點Sitej傳輸到Sitek的過程的資源消耗,其值的計算方法為CSS(Dri,j,k)=(|Cjk|+|Dri|)×cjk,其中|Cjk|表示站點Sitej到Sitek的連接長度,|Dri|表示關系數據集合Dri的數據長度,cjk表示單位數據資源消耗;
CST(Dri,j,k)表示關系數據集合Dri從站點Sitej傳輸到Sitek的過程的時間消耗,其值的計算方法為CST(Dri,j,k)=(|Cjk|+|Dri|)×tjk,其中tjk表示單位數據的傳輸時間;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于李富平,未經李富平許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810396475.5/2.html,轉載請聲明來源鉆瓜專利網。





